Aspirin that has been stored for a long time may give a vinegar like odour and give a purple colour with FeCl3. What reaction wo
iVinArrow [24]

Answer:

See explanation

Explanation:

The IUPAC name of aspirin is 2-Acetoxybenzoic acid. It is composed of an acetoxy moiety and a benzoic acid moiety.

The compound can be hydrolysed under prolonged storage conditions to yield acetic acid which causes the vinegar like odour.

Also, one of the products of this hydrolysis bears a phenol group which reacts with FeCl3 to give a purple color.

What is the h oh ph and poh of a 0.005m solution of calcium hydroxide?
fiasKO [112]

Answer: [OH^{-}]= 0.01M or 1.0\times 10^{-2}M

[H^{+}]= 1.0\times 10^{-12}M

pH = 12

pOH = 2

Explanation: Calcium hydroxide (Ca(OH)_{2}) is a strong base that dissociates completely.

Dissociation equation of Calcium hydroxide is :

Ca(OH)_{2} \rightarrow Ca^{+2} + 2OH^{-}

1. Concentration of [OH-]

1 mol Ca(OH)_{2} produces 2 mol OH- ions.

The given solution is 0.005M Ca(OH)_{2} , then  concentration of OH- would be twice the concentration of Ca(OH)_{2}

[OH^{-}] = 0.005\times 2 = 0.01M or 1.0\times 10^{-2}M

2.Concentration of [H+]

Concentration of [H+] can be calculated by the formula: [H^{+}] = \frac{Kw}{[OH^{-}]}

kw = ionic product of water and its values is (1\times 10^{-14})

[OH-] = 0.01 M or 1.0\times 10^{-2}M

[H^{+}] = \frac{(1\times 10^{-14})}{[OH^{-}]}

[H^{+}] = \frac{(1\times 10^{-14})}{[0.01]}

[H^{+}] = 1.0\times 10^{-12}M

3. pH value

pH is calculated by the formula : pH = -log[H^{+}]

pH = -log[1.0\times 10^{-12}]

pH = 12

4. pOH value

pOH is calculated by the formula : pOH = 14 - pH

pOH = 14 - 12

pOH = 2

pOH can also be calculated by using a different formula which is :

pOH = -log(OH^{-})

pOH = -log(0.01)

pOH = 2.
